The Robert Portner Brewing Company, founded in Alexandria, Virginia, was a prominent pre-Prohibition brewery. Established by Robert Portner, the company flourished from 1869 until it was forced to close in 1916 due to Prohibition. Portner was known for his innovative contributions to brewing, including early air conditioning systems. The company's Tivoli Brewery produced popular beers like Tivoli Hofbrau.
